Output 3625382479fd1da99160c8177ca5b472c9d007eccfb191a014646718f31d1ccd:6

value
149087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868d691440acede08a14f441363fa32f74df9c99 OP_EQUAL
address
3DxTscwJicyj6R7psMiViHrvZ7cQRYMNiJ
transaction
3625382479fd1da99160c8177ca5b472c9d007eccfb191a014646718f31d1ccd
spent
true